Winnebago, IL to York, IL is 290.3 miles and takes about 5h 51m via I 39 and I 74, with a fuel budget near $45 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This road trip stays within the Midwest, primarily traversing Illinois. Expect a highway-focused drive that's efficient for getting from point A to point B. With a recommended single day for completion, this route is ideal for those looking to cover ground without extensive detours. It's a straightforward journey across the state.

This drive is heavily focused on the highway, with 72% of the route utilizing major interstates like I 39 and I 74. You'll experience long stretches of consistent speed, including an uninterrupted 118.2 miles on I 39. The journey generally maintains a consistent character throughout, prioritizing direct travel over varied road types. While South Main Street is mentioned as part of the route, the dominant experience is that of efficient interstate cruising.
This is a straightforward highway drive that stays mostly on I 39 and I 74. You will hit about 9 points where you need to pay attention to lane position or signs. The trickiest moment comes around 133.4 miles in near US 51.
